database.sarang.net
UserID
Passwd
Database
DBMS
MySQL
PostgreSQL
Firebird
Oracle
ㆍInformix
Sybase
MS-SQL
DB2
Cache
CUBRID
LDAP
ALTIBASE
Tibero
DB 문서들
스터디
Community
공지사항
자유게시판
구인|구직
DSN 갤러리
도움주신분들
Admin
운영게시판
최근게시물
Informix Q&A 2465 게시물 읽기
No. 2465
인포믹스에도 rollup 이라는 예약어 있나요?
작성자
수진
작성일
2008-02-19 09:25
조회수
7,408

인포믹스에도 rollup 이라는 예약어 있나요?
찾다가 못찾아서 물어봅니다.

select a, sum(e), sum(f)
from table
(multiset
(
select a,b,c,d, sum(e) as e, sum(f) as f from table1 
group by a,b,c,d
)
)
group by a

원래는 쿼리가 위와 같은데요.. 위와 같이 하면 인라인 뷰쪽의 쿼리 건수가 3만건 정도 되는데 다시 group by 해 보니
하다가 중단되네요;;

그래서 인데요?
select a,b,c,d, sum(e) as e, sum(f) as f from table1 
group by rollup(a,b,c,d)

위와 같이 rollup 있나요?

이 글에 대한 댓글이 총 1건 있습니다.

informix에는 rollup 이라는 예약어는 없는것으로 알고 있습니다.


그러나 roll up같이 쓰이는 예약어는 있어요.


union all 이라는 것으로


다음의 예제를 참고해서 써보시기 바랍니다.


create table t1(member_id int,

              name varchar(10),

              zip   char(7),

              address varchar(20));

 

insert into t1 values(1, "aaa","111-111","seoul");

insert into t1 values(2, "bbb","111-222","seoul kangdong gu");

insert into t1 values(3, "ccc","111-333","seoul kangseo gu");

insert into t1 values(4, "ddd","222-222","daegu kangdong gu");

insert into t1 values(5, "eee","222-333","daegu kangseo gu");

select * from t1;

  member_id name       zip     address

          1 aaa        111-111 seoul

          2 bbb        111-222 seoul kangdong gu

          3 ccc        111-333 seoul kangseo gu

          4 ddd        222-222 daegu kangdong gu

          5 eee        222-333 daegu kangseo gu

// zip code 앞 3자리로 grouping 하여 소계를 내는 것입니다

select substr(zip,1,3), count(member_id) .

from t1

group by 1

union all

select "total", count(member_id)

from t1;

 

(expression)          (count)

111                         3

222                         2

total                        5

김선규(cbspd)님이 2008-02-22 12:58에 작성한 댓글입니다.
[Top]
No.
제목
작성자
작성일
조회
2468테이블이나 DB의 접근했던정보를 보는방법은 없나요? [1]
김현철
2008-02-21
6224
2467[질문] informix의 함수 내에서 order by 문을 사용할 수 없나요? [1]
김보현
2008-02-21
6619
2466INFOMIX 가 떠있는지 아닌지 서버에서 어떻게 확인하는건가요? [1]
갱지갱
2008-02-20
6316
2465인포믹스에도 rollup 이라는 예약어 있나요? [1]
수진
2008-02-19
7408
2464AIX에서 Informix ESQL/C 컴파일 오류 [3]
박찬윤
2008-02-15
8411
2462인포믹스 관련 자료 블로그
김기복
2008-02-14
7375
2461onstat -u 를 해서 user를 보면 root와 informix 가 나오는데...... [8]
ㅠㅠ
2008-02-13
7876
Valid XHTML 1.0!
All about the DATABASE... Copyleft 1999-2021 DSN, All rights reserved.
작업시간: 0.029초, 이곳 서비스는
	PostgreSQL v13.3으로 자료를 관리합니다